Indonesia's Papua Region Shaken by 6.1 Earthquake, Infrastructure Damaged in Remote Coastal Town
A powerful 6.1-magnitude earthquake struck Indonesia's easternmost Papua region early Friday, collapsing homes and a critical bridge in the coastal town of Nabire while highlighting the vulnerability of infrastructure in one of the country's most remote and seismically active areas. The tremor, centered just 28 kilometers from populated areas, underscores the ongoing challenges Indonesia faces in disaster preparedness across its sprawling archipelago of over 17,000 islands.
Immediate Impact and Infrastructure Damage
The earthquake caused significant structural damage in Nabire, Central Papua Province, with at least two houses collapsing and the town's main bridge suffering damage, according to Suharyanto, head of Indonesia's National Disaster Mitigation Agency. The bridge collapse is particularly concerning as it likely serves as a vital transportation link in a region where infrastructure connectivity is already limited.
Additional damage was reported to a government office, a church, and the local airport, though the extent of the airport damage and its impact on air travel—often the primary means of transportation in Papua's mountainous terrain—remains unclear. Communication networks were disrupted across Nabire and several surrounding towns, complicating initial damage assessments.
Seismic Context: Papua's Position on the Ring of Fire
The earthquake's shallow depth of 10 kilometers, as recorded by the U.S. Geological Survey, explains why the tremor caused notable surface damage despite being classified as a moderate earthquake. Papua sits along the highly active Pacific Ring of Fire, where the Indo-Australian and Pacific tectonic plates meet, making the region particularly susceptible to seismic activity.
Indonesia experiences thousands of earthquakes annually, with many going unnoticed due to their remote locations or minimal impact. However, Friday's quake serves as a reminder of the 2004 Indian Ocean tsunami that killed over 230,000 people across multiple countries, with Indonesia bearing the heaviest casualties.
Emergency Response and Population Reaction
Residents immediately fled their homes for higher ground when the earthquake struck, demonstrating the ingrained disaster awareness that has developed among Indonesian populations following decades of seismic events. This rapid evacuation response likely prevented casualties, as no injuries were reported in initial assessments.
Indonesia's Meteorology, Climatology and Geophysics Agency quickly ruled out tsunami risks, noting that the earthquake's epicenter was located inland rather than beneath the ocean floor. This rapid communication is crucial in a country where tsunami warnings can trigger mass evacuations across coastal areas.
Broader Implications for Indonesia's Disaster Management
The incident highlights both strengths and weaknesses in Indonesia's disaster response capabilities. While early warning systems and public awareness appear effective in preventing casualties, the infrastructure damage in a relatively moderate earthquake raises questions about building standards and disaster resilience in remote regions.
Papua's geographic isolation—located over 3,000 kilometers from Jakarta—often complicates disaster response efforts and infrastructure development. The region's mountainous terrain, limited road networks, and dependence on air and sea transportation make it particularly vulnerable to extended disruptions following natural disasters.
As Indonesia continues to develop its eastern provinces, Friday's earthquake serves as a reminder that disaster-resistant infrastructure and robust communication systems remain essential investments for protecting remote communities along one of the world's most seismically active zones.
